-
Suction is created by placing special cups made of plastic or silicone on the skin. A vacuum or suction force is created inside the cup by a mechanical pump that pulls skin and underlying tissue upward into the cup.

-
Chinese medicine technique that involves scraping your skin with smooth-edged massage tools. It lifts stagnation, clears congestion, and restores glide between the skin, fascia, and underlying tissues.
